Understanding Nauru

Nauru is a tiny island nation located in the Pacific Ocean, renowned for its stunning landscapes and rich cultural heritage. The country is one of the least populated countries in the world, with an area of just 21 square kilometers. Challenges and Considerations

Despite the advantages, potential applicants should also be mindful of certain challenges and considerations:

  • Economic Stability: Nauru’s economy has faced ups and downs, primarily due to the depletion of phosphate resources. It’s crucial for investors to consider the long-term sustainability of their investments.
  • Cultural Differences: Adapting to a small island nation’s culture and lifestyle may require flexibility and open-mindedness.
  • Accessibility: Nauru is relatively remote, and travel options may be limited as compared to larger nations, which can affect accessibility for business or personal visits.
